Top Eagle Attractions

  • 1. Eagle River Preserve: This beautiful nature preserve offers scenic trails for hiking, biking, and wildlife viewing. Visitors can enjoy the serene surroundings and explore the diverse flora and fauna of the area.
  • 2. Sylvan Lake State Park: Located just outside of Eagle, Sylvan Lake State Park is a popular destination for outdoor enthusiasts. Visitors can enjoy activities such as fishing, boating, camping, and hiking in this picturesque mountain setting.
  • 3. Castle Peak: For those seeking adventure and stunning panoramic views, Castle Peak is a must-visit attraction. This challenging hike offers breathtaking vistas of the surrounding mountains and valleys.
  • 4. Eagle County Historical Society Museum: History enthusiasts will appreciate a visit to the Eagle County Historical Society Museum. This small museum showcases the rich history and heritage of the area through exhibits and artifacts.
  • 5. Bonfire Brewing: After a day of exploring, visitors can unwind at Bonfire Brewing, a local craft brewery in Eagle. Here, they can sample a variety of handcrafted beers and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ere of this popular gathering spot.

About “Virtual Interlining”: Some itineraries may combine multiple airlines without a traditional interline agreement. This can unlock routes that are otherwise hard to find, but it can also increase complexity (separate tickets, tighter connections, baggage rules, and responsibility for missed connections).
